Self Emptying Robot Vacuums

Robot vacuums that self-empty allow you to clean without touching anything. They do not require you to clean or empty their bins which is a major benefit for those with allergies.

The robot will instead dump its contents in a larger base that can store dirt for 45 to 60 days. Then, it will empty itself before returning to its dock.

Runtime Improved

The majority of robot vacuums have an onboard dustbin, which is to be empty at the end of every cleaning cycle. Auto-emptying gives users an easy hands-free experience. This feature is available on some models at the entry level however it's a major selling point for a lot of high-end robot vacuums.

Self-emptying robot cleaners can save homeowners a lot of time. If you have to manage children, work and chores don't want to be bothered by having to stop their robotic cleaner to empty the onboard dust bin. Self-emptying models provide users with the ease of keeping a clean home without needing to stop their robot cleaner.

Certain models that self-empty are able to mop as well, in addition to their main functions. These robots automatically empty their mopping tank and refill it with fresh water to prepare for the next cleaning cycle. These models can also clean and dry the pads. This will ensure that the robot is ready for its next cleaning cycle and prevent the buildup of dirt inside the robot.

Less downtime

Standard robot vacuums store dirt and debris in an internal dust bin that they must empty after every couple of cleaning cycles. Self-emptying platforms eliminate this step and allows the machine to continue working between sessions without interruption. This helps reduce the time between cleaning sessions, and also allows larger homes to be cleaned from wall-to-wall in one session.

Some self-emptying models also allow you to program cleaning schedules and use voice assistants like Alexa or Google Assistant to control the device. You can set no-go zones, track the robot's movements, and alter settings like suction power or the amount of water distributed to floors. These options may be added, but can help you get the most from your robotic vacuum.

A self-emptying robot vacuum can also make it unnecessary to touch and dump the container this is an advantage for those with allergies or who have other tasks to do in their home. The base can store months or weeks of dirt and debris. You will only need to empty the base every 30 to 60 days, Self emptying robot vacuums which is the same timeframe you have to change the bin in the regular vacuum.

A self-emptying robot vacuum takes the idea a step further by taking care of its own collection containers between cleaning sessions.

These robots have small dustbins that are often only four inches high. They don't have enough space to hold a large dust bin, like one you'd find on the Dyson upright. They also are generally not bagless and require frequent manual emptying because the full bin can get clogged with hairballs, and other debris.

The cleaners don't empty their dustbins manually, but instead transfer all dirt into a bag at the base of the docking station. The model of the bag will determine how much. the bags are generally designed to prevent dust leakage and minimize allergen dissemination.

This hands-free maintenance is not only less irritating, but it allows the robot to run longer between emptying cycles. The robot does not have to go back to the base to empty its collection canister before it can continue to operate. Robots that are hands-free can clean more rooms in a single session due to the decreased downtime.

The simplified maintenance is also more convenient for people with hectic schedules, whether they are homeowners or parents. This means that you can run your automated cleaner without stopping repeatedly throughout the week to empty the collection canister.
